Engine Oil for the 2011 Toyota Vitz Yaris: Why It Matters and How to Keep It Right

The 2011 Toyota Vitz Yaris, known for its reliability and efficiency, definitely uses engine oil. Engine oil is an essential part of the vehicle's operation, and it plays a crucial role in keeping the engine running smoothly. So, engine oil is absolutely relevant and necessary for this model, and skipping on it is not an option for anyone wanting their car to last.

Engine oil is often overlooked, but it serves several key purposes in the 2011 Toyota Vitz Yaris. It lubricates the moving parts inside the engine, helping to reduce friction and prevent wear and tear. Without proper lubrication, metal components would grind against each other, causing major damage and shortening the engine's lifespan. It also acts as a coolant, carrying heat away from engine components and preventing overheating. Additionally, engine oil helps keep the engine clean by picking up dirt, debris, and microscopic metal particles, carrying them to the oil filter where they're trapped.

Of course, engine oil also aids in sealing the gaps between piston rings and cylinder walls, which helps the engine maintain compression and run efficiently. And finally, it protects engine parts from corrosion by neutralising acids that form during fuel combustion.

For a 2011 Toyota Vitz Yaris, the choice of engine oil is important. Toyota typically recommends using oils that meet specific standards for viscosity and quality, often looking for oils that comply with API (American Petroleum Institute) standards or ACEA (European Automobile Manufacturers' Association) ratings. The recommended viscosity for this engine usually falls around 5W-30 or 10W-30, but it's always best to check the owner's manual or a trusted Toyota service resource to make sure you're using the right grade.

So, how often must you change the engine oil on your Vitz Yaris? Well, servicing schedules vary depending on driving conditions, but a good rule of thumb for regular city driving is an oil change every 10,000 to 15,000 kilometres, or roughly every 6 to 12 months. If the car is used in harsh conditions, like frequent short trips, dusty environments, or extreme temperatures, more frequent oil changes may be necessary.

Here's what you need to know about keeping the engine oil in top shape for your 2011 Toyota Vitz Yaris:

  • Regularly check the oil level using the dipstick. Low oil can quickly damage the engine, so topping it up between oil changes is a must.
  • Always use the type and grade of engine oil recommended by Toyota to maintain optimal engine performance and efficiency.
  • Replace the oil filter at every oil change. A clogged filter reduces oil flow and can let contaminants circulate inside the engine.
  • Consider your driving style and conditions. If you do a lot of stop-start driving, short trips, or drive in dusty or very cold/hot climates, the oil might need changing more frequently.
  • Keep an eye out for any oil leaks or unusual engine noises, as these could indicate a problem with the oil system or engine health.

Performing timely oil changes and regular checks helps prevent engine wear, preserve fuel efficiency, and ensure your Toyota Vitz Yaris runs well for years. Some drivers choose synthetic oils for improved performance and longer intervals between changes. Synthetic oils generally provide better protection at extreme temperatures and resist breakdown, but they can cost more upfront.
